Brazilian television institution Fausto Corrêa da Silva, better known simply as Faustão, was caught on camera during a taping of his long-running variety show wearing what is unquestionably one of the most technically singular watches money can buy: the HYT H1 Colour Block in Yellow, a limited edition of just ten pieces. The sighting, captured on the set of his TV Globo programme, is the kind of wrist-check moment that stops horological enthusiasts mid-scroll.

The HYT H1 is the watch that put the Geneva-based brand on the map when it debuted in 2012, introducing the world to hydro-mechanical timekeeping on a commercial scale. Rather than conventional hands or a disc, the H1 uses two flexible micro-reservoirs — bellows — that push a luminescent fluid through a curved capillary tube arcing across the lower half of the dial. The yellow fluid advances to indicate the hours; when it reaches 6 o'clock, it snaps back and the cycle begins again. Minutes are displayed via a traditional retrograde hand on the upper dial sector. The movement powering this system is an in-house manual-wind calibre H1, beating at 28,800 vph with a 65-hour power reserve. Case diameter is 48.8 mm in blackened titanium — substantial but surprisingly wearable given titanium's low density.

The Colour Block series elevated the H1's already bold visual language into statement territory. The all-yellow treatment — dial accents, capillary fluid, and monochromatic rubber strap — creates an aggressive, motorsport-adjacent aesthetic that references neither classical haute horlogerie nor mere sportswatching. At ten pieces globally, this is a watch most collectors will never see in the metal, let alone acquire.

On the secondary market, the H1 Colour Block Yellow commands serious attention. With a UK list price of approximately £30,000 (roughly $38,000 USD at prevailing rates), and given the ten-piece production limit, grey-market values tend to firm up rather than soften — a rarity in an era when many limited editions disappoint at resale. Collectors seeking one should expect to pay at or above retail.
